I believe homework gives you the chance to learn things that you didn't in class, to figure it out the harder problems. When I was in dif. cal. last year I failed with a 70. (that was failing at this school) So I had to take the class over, and this time the teacher gave us homework, due to the homework I make a 98 in the class. So I do like homework.